Congratulations to Finn for completing 1000 Books Before Kindergarten. Do you have a newborn, infant, or toddler? You can sign them up for our 1000 Books Before Kindergarten program and they can start earning rewards for each reading milestone. Read the same book 10 times a day to your child? It all counts towards your 1000 books. ... Stop by the Library or call for more information! #sierramadrepubliclibrary #mysierramadrelibrary

Join us for three exciting financial literacy seminars on Zoom! Each session will arm parents with tips and ideas on how to speak to their young children about money. You’ll be able to explain how money works, pass on the gift of financial knowledge, and help weigh the pros and cons regarding the various college-saving options available today. Led by proud single mom Veronica Vasquez, a financial services professional. Q&A after each session. Every Saturday morning, the onli...ne seminar begins at 9:00 AM PST on January 16th, 23rd, and 30th. Each seminar will be about an hour long, and is geared for parents and not for the children. Call the Library at (626) 355-7186 to register. #sierramadrepubliclibrary #mysierramadrelibrary

Last week we were introduced to a new hula, Christmas Lu'au by Waimanalo Keikis and artists. Today, we're learning the hand movements. The hands are the most important part, they are what tell the story of the song. Join Librarian Leila as she teaches you a new hula choreography. Please remember, Librarian Leila is not a Kumu (teacher) and does this simply to share her culture, share her knowledge, and for fun. Mahalo nui loa (thank you very much). #sierramadrepubliclibrary #mysierramadrelibrary
